* { margin: 0; border: 0; padding: 0; }

html, body {
	background: #f0eeef url("imagens/bgTopo.jpg") repeat-x center top;
	zscrollbar-face-color: #333;
	zscrollbar-track-color: #333;
	zscrollbar-arrow-color: #0A0B0D;
	zscrollbar-highlight-color: #333;
	zscrollbar-3dlight-color: #0A0B0D;
	zscrollbar-darkshadow-color: #333;
	zscrollbar-shadow-color: #0A0B0D;
}
#Interno {
	margin: 10px 20px;
}
#Interno2 {
	margin: 2px 12px;
	zborder: solid 1px red;
	}
#InternoBusca {
	margin: 40px 8px;
}
#Link1 {
	zborder: solid 1px red;
	height: 55px;
	width: 95px;
	cursor: pointer;
}

body, td, div, p, a{ font: 16px Trebuchet MS, Arial, verdana; color: #333; text-decoration: none; padding: 0px; }


a:hover { text-decoration: underline;}
a img	{ border: 0; }

#Link2 a:hover { text-decoration: underline; color: white; }

input, textarea, select {
	font: 13px Trebuchet MS, Arial, tahoma;
	text-align: middle;
	border: 1px solid #d1d1d1;
	padding: 1px;
	background-color: #fff;
	margin: 4px;
}
 
input { vertical-align: middle; }

textarea { overflow: auto; }

h1 { 
    font: bold 18px Trebuchet MS, Arial, tahoma;
	color: #fff; 
	background: transparent url("imagens/bgTitulo.gif") no-repeat left top;
	line-height: 50px;
	width: 710px;
	margin-top: 5px;
	margin-bottom: 10px;
	padding: 0 0 0 10px;
	zborder: solid 1px red;
}

h2 { font: bold 16px Trebuchet MS, Arial, tahoma; color: #000; text-transform: uppercase; word-spacing: 2px; letter-spacing: 0px; margin: 10px 0 10px 0; zborder-bottom: 1px dotted #000; }
h3 { font: bold 18px Trebuchet MS, Arial, tahoma; color: #fff;  padding: 10px 0; margin-bottom: 20px; }
h4 { font: bold 14px Trebuchet MS, Arial, tahoma; color: #000; margin: 0 0 10px 0; }
h5 { font: bold 12px Trebuchet MS, Arial, tahoma; color: #000; margin: 0px; }
b { font: bold 15px Trebuchet MS, Arial, tahoma; color: #000; margin: 0px; }

#interno {
	margin: 0 16px;
}

img#Foto {
	border: 10px solid #e2e2e2;
}

#AreaSite {
	background: transparent;
	text-align: left;
	width: 915px;
	height: auto;
	zborder: 1px solid #e2e6e7;
}

#Topo {
	background: transparent;
	height: 250px;
	width: 950px;
}
#TopoMeio {
	background: transparent;
	height: 160px;
	width: 905px;
	margin-top: 5px;
	zborder: red 1px solid;
}

#busca {
	background: transparent url("imagens/bgBusca.jpg") no-repeat center top;
	float: right;
	height: 133px;
	width: 385px;
	margin-top: 0px;
	margin-left: 5px;
	zborder: 1px solid red;
}
#buscaJornal{
	background: transparent url("imagens/bgJornal.jpg") no-repeat center  top;
	float: right;
	height: 133px;
	width: 175px;
	margin-top: 1px;
	margin-right: -7px;
	margin-bottom: 0px;
	amargin-left: 10px;
	zborder: red 1px solid;
}
#AreaConteudo {
	background: #f0eeef transparent;
	height: auto;
	width: 950px;
	margin: 10px 0;
	zborder: red 1px solid; 
}
#ConteudoEsquerda {
	font: bold 11px Trebuchet MS, Arial, tahoma;
	background: transparent;
	float: left;
	height: 500px;
	width: 170px;
	margin: 6px 0 0 0;
	zborder: red 1px solid; 
}
#Tel {
	background:  url("imagens/bgTel.jpg") no-repeat center top;
	height: 160px;
	width: 170px;
	margin: -1PX 0 0 0;
	zborder: green 1px solid;
}

#Newsletter{
	background: #fff url("imagens/bgEsquerda.jpg") repeat-x center top;
	height: auto;
	width: 170px;
	font: bold 9px Trebuchet MS, Arial, tahoma;
	amargin: 0;
	zborder: green 1px solid;

}
#FaleConosco{
	background: #fff url("imagens/bgEsquerda.jpg") repeat-x center top;
	height: 170px;
	width: 170px;
	margin-bottom: 10px;
	zborder: green 1px solid;

}
#AreaConteudoCento{
	
	background: #f0eeef transparent;
	float: left;
	height: auto;
	width: 715px;
	margin-left: 15px ;
	zborder: red 1px solid; 
}
#ImagemMeio2{
	height: 211px;
	width: 725px;
	margin-top: 9px;
	margin-left: 12px;
	position: absolute;
	zborder: green 1px solid;
}
#ImagemMeio{
	background: transparent url("imagens/bgImagemMeio.gif") no-repeat center top;
	height: 227px;
	width: 728px;
	margin-top: -50px;
	margin-left: -5px;
	position: absolute;
	zborder: green 1px solid;
}

#ImagemMine{
	background: transparent url("imagens/bgMine.jpg") no-repeat  top ;
	height:225px;
	width: 165px;
	padding-top: 4px;
	margin-top: 8px;
	margin-right: 19px;
	margin-left: 0px;
	margin-bottom: 0px;
	float: left;
	position: relative;
	cursor: pointer;
	zborder: green 1px solid;
}
#ImagemMine2{
	background: transparent url("imagens/bgMine.jpg") no-repeat  top ;
	height:225px;
	width: 165px;
	padding-top: 4px;
	margin-top: 8px;
	margin-right: -4px;
	margin-left: 0px;
	margin-bottom: 0px;
	float: right;
	zposition: relative;
	cursor: pointer;
	Zborder: green 1px solid;
}
#Miolo{
	clear: both;
	background: transparent url("imagens/miolo.jpg") repeat-y center top;
	min-height: 655px;
	height: 670x;
	width: 720px;
	margin-top: -11px;
	margin-left: -1px;
	margin-bottom: -5px;
	aposition: relative;
	zborder: green 1px solid;
}
html>body #Miolo {
	height: auto;
	margin-bottom: -15px;
}
/* Menu Top ------------------------ */

#Menu {
	background: transparent url("imagens/bgMenu.jpg") repeat-y center top;
	color: #fff;
	width: 910px;
	height: 55px;
	margin: 0 0 0 0;
	zborder: green 1px solid;
}

#Menu ul {
	height: 55px;
	list-style-type: none; /*remove o marcador*/ 
	margin:  0; /*remove o recuo IE e Opera*/ 
	padding: 0px; /*remove o recuo Mozilla e NN*/ 
}

#Menu ul li {
	display: inline; 
	float: left;
	list-style-position: inside;
	text-decoration: none;
	margin: 0 0 0 0;
	height: 55px;
	aborder-bottom: solid 15px transparent;
}

#Menu ul li a       {text-decoration: none; margin: 0 0 0 0; padding: 5px 19px; font: bold 14px Arial, Tahoma; color: #c1dea8;}
#Menu ul li a:hover {text-decoration: none; margin: 0 0 0 0; padding: 18px 19px; color: #fff; background: #1e1b12; border-bottom: solid 5px #1e1b12; line-height: 55px; }

#Menu ul li a.selec       {text-decoration: none; margin: 0 0 0 0; padding: 18px 20px; color: #fff; background: #1e1b12; border-bottom: solid 5px #1e1b12; line-height: 55px;  }
#Menu ul li a.selec:hover {text-decoration: none; margin: 0 0 0 0; padding: 18px 20px; color: #fff; background: #1e1b12; border-bottom: solid 5px #1e1b12; line-height: 55px;  cursor: default;}

/* -------Rodape------------- */

#Rodape {padding: 2px; clear: both; margin-top: 0px; color: #fff; background: #f0eeef url("imagens/bgRodape.gif") repeat-x center top; height: 180px; width: auto; zborder: red 2px solid;}
#Rodape #Interno{ margin-top: 0; }
#Rodape #Interno a { font: bold 12px Trebuchet MS, Arial, tahoma; color: #f6c100; }


#Rodape2 {
	color: #fff;
	margin-top: -53px;
	margin-left: 180px;
	width: 600px;
	font: bold 14px Trebuchet MS, Arial, tahoma;
	zborder: red 2px solid;
}

#trust {
	width:30px;
	margin-top: 12px;
	margin-right: 2px;
	float: right;
	aposition: relative;
	zborder: solid red 1px;
	
}

#rodapeMiolo {
	margin-top: 100px;
	height: 50px;
	text-align: left;
	width: 915px;
	Zborder: solid red 1px;

}

.Credito {
	margin-left: -17px;
	margin-top: 0px;
	color: #fff;
	 font: bold 12px Trebuchet MS, Arial, tahoma;
}
/* ------------------------- */

#Botao {
	margin: 0 0 0 0;
	text-align: middle;
	color: #fff; 
	border: 1px solid #d1d1d1;
	padding: 1px;
	background-color: #3f6d35;
	font: bold 13px Trebuchet MS, Arial, tahoma;
	
}
#BotaoJornal {
	margin: 0 0 0 0;
	text-align: middle;
	color: #fff; 
	border: 1px solid #d1d1d1;
	padding: 1px;
	background-color: #3f6d35;
	font: bold 11px Trebuchet MS, Arial, tahoma;
	
}
#Botao2 {
	margin: -30px 0 0 0px;
	text-align: middle;
	color: #fff; 
	border: 1px solid #d1d1d1;
	padding: 1px;
	background-color: #3f6d35;
	float: right;
	font: bold 13px Trebuchet MS, Arial, tahoma;
}
#BotaoBusca {
	margin: -30px 0 0 0px;
	text-align: middle;
	color: #fff; 
	border: 1px solid #d1d1d1;
	padding: 1px;
	background-color: #3f6d35;
	float: right;
	font: bold 11px Trebuchet MS, Arial, tahoma;
}

#BotaoVoltar {
	background: transparent url("../imagens/BotaoVoltar.jpg") no-repeat center center;
	width: 120px; height: 46px;
	border: 0px;
	font: bold;

}

#BotaoEnviar {
	background: transparent url("../imagens/BotaoEnviar.jpg") no-repeat center center;
	width: 120px; height: 46px;
	border: 0px;
	font: bold;
}

#Branco {
	background: transparent;
	border: 0;
}

#Voltar {
	background: #fff;
	float: right;
	text-align: right;
	width: auto;
	zborder-top: 2px solid #d1d1d1;
	margin: -30px 0 0 0;
	padding: 20px 0 0 0;
	zfont: bold;
}
.Voltar {
	float: right;
	text-align: right;
	width: auto;
	border-top: 2px solid #d1d1d1;
	margin: 10px 0 0 0;
	padding: 10px 0 0 0;
	font: bold;
}

.LightBoxMini {
	background: #fff;
	margin: 15px;
	border: 1px solid #aeaeae;
	float: left;
}

.LightBoxMiniHover {
	background: #e2e2e2;
	margin: 17px;
	border: 1px solid #aeaeae;
	float: left;
}

#InternoBusca2 {
	margin: 38px 18px;
}

.FotoLightBoxMini {
	width: 95px; height: 71px;
	margin: 6px;
}
.Radio {
	border: 0px solid #A4C29B; background: #fff;

}

.Branco {
	font: 11px Tahoma; height: 16px;
	border: 0; background: #fff; padding: 0; margin: 0;
}

#link {
	margin: 5px 0 10px 0;
	text-align: right;
}

#link2 {
	margin: 5px 0 0 0;
	text-align: right;
}

.AlinhaProduto {
	text-align: center; float: left;
	padding: 10px; width: 110px; height: 180px;
}

.CortaPreco {
	color: ff0000; text-decoration: line-through;
}

hr {
	color: #343434; height: 1px;
}

.SeparaImovel {
	clear: both;
	border: 1px dotted #E3E3E3; margin: 15px 0;
}

.SeparaImovelFoto {
	clear: both;
	border: 1px dotted #fff; margin: 0px;
}

.SeparaMenuEmpresa {
	zxcclear: both;
	border: 1px dotted #E3E3E3; margin: 15px 5px;
}

.Valor {
	text-align: right;
	height: 20px;
}

.ImovelMini {
	border: 1px solid #aeaeae; margin-right: 6px; margin-bottom: 3px; padding: 3px;
	float: left;
	height: 32px;
}

.ImovelMiniHover {
	border: 1px solid #330000; margin-right: 6px; padding: 3px;
	background: #b2dfa5;
	float: left;
	height: 32px;
}

.FotoImovelMini {
	border: 1px solid #fff;
	width: 40px; height: 30px;
}

.SeparaPequenasFotosImovel {
	clear: both;
	border: none; margin: 0px;
}

.CantoFoto {
	position: absolute; margin: -4px 0 0 36px;
}

.Imovel {
	border: 1px solid #000;
	width: 160px; height: 120px; margin: 0 13px 0 0;
}

.FotoImovelDestaque {
	border: 1px solid #000;
	width: 80px; height: 60px; margin: 0 0 0 0;
}

#Interno3 {
	margin: 2px 13px;
	cursor: pointer;
}

.FotoImovelCapa {
	border: 1px solid #407036;
	width: 140px; height: 105px; margin: 5px 0px 0px 0px;
}

.ImovelDetalhe {
	width: 640px; height: 480px; margin: 0 10px 0 0;
}
.botao {
	float: right;
	font: 12px Tahoma, Times;
	color: #000;
	margin:  -20px 0 0 10px;
}
.botao2 {
	afloat: right;
	font: 12px Tahoma, Times;
	color: #000;
	margin: 5px 0;
	padding: 2px;
}
/* =============================================================================================== */
/* =============================================================================================== */
/* =============================================================================================== */


h6 { font: bold 16px Trebuchet MS, Arial, tahoma; color: #0066b3;	padding-left: 5px;	background-color: #dcddde; }

hr {
	border: 1px dotted #E3E3E3;
	margin: 10px;
	padding: 0;
	height: 2px;
}

p {
	margin: 0 0 10px 0;
}

ul.li{
	list-style-position: inside;
	list-style-type: none; /*remove o marcador*/ 
	margin:  0; /*remove o recuo IE e Opera*/ 
	padding: 0px; /*remove o recuo Mozilla e NN*/ 
}

li{
	list-style-position: inside;
	list-style-type: none; /*remove o marcador*/ 
	margin:  0; /*remove o recuo IE e Opera*/ 
	padding: 0px; /*remove o recuo Mozilla e NN*/ 
}
.Credito {
	aposition: absolute; bottom: 0px; right: 0;
	width: 29px; height: 27px;
}

.Credito a { background: transparent; width: 29px; height: 27px; display: block; }
.Credito a:hover { background-position: 0px -27px; border: 0; }


/* -------------
#Miolo {
	min-height: 250px; height: 250px;
	zborder: 1px solid #3336e7;
}


#NoticiaCapa {
	background: transparent url("../imagens/bgNoticia.jpg") no-repeat center top;
	width: 580px;
	height: 300px;
	float: right;
	margin: 20px 0 0 0;
}
#NoticiaCapa #Interno { margin: 80px 30px 0 30px; }


#InicioUsuario {
	float: right;
	color: #fff;
	margin-top: 6px;
	margin-right: -18px;
	text-align: right;
	color: #fff;
	font: 13px Arial, Tahoma;
}


#InicioContato {
	color: #fff;
	font: 13px Arial, Tahoma;
}

#InicioContato ul {
	list-style-type: none; /*remove o marcador 
	margin:  0; /*remove o recuo IE e Opera 
	padding: 0px; /*remove o recuo Mozilla e NN 
	font: 13px Arial, Tahoma;
}


#InicioContato ul li{
	display: inline; 
	margin-right: 4px;
	list-style-position: inside;
	text-decoration: none;
}

#InicioContato ul li.selec a {text-decoration: underline; color: #fff;}


#UsuarioSenha {
	color: #fff;
	font: 13px Arial, Tahoma;
	margin-top: 19px;
}

#FundoNoticia {
	position: relative;
	width: 260px;
	height: 159px;
	margin: 13px 0 0 10px;
	float: left;
	background: transparent url("../imagens/FundoNoticia.gif") no-repeat center;
}

#ConteudoNoticia {
	margin: 18px 8px;
	width: 241px;
	height: 115px;
	zbackground-color: #E8E8E8;

}

#VoltarPagina {
	width: 66px;
	height: 32px;
	border: none;
	float: left;
	font: bold 8px Trebuchet MS, Arial, tahoma; color: #00a650;
	background: transparent url("../imagens/Voltar.gif") no-repeat center;
}


html>body #Miolo {
	height: auto;
}

#Interno {
	margin: 20px 30px 30px 30px;
}

#CalendarioCapa {
	background: transparent url("../imagens/bgCalendario.jpg") no-repeat center top;
	font-weight: bold;
	width: 300px;
	height: 300px;
	float: left;
	margin: 20px 0 0 0;
}
#CalendarioCapa #Interno { margin: 30px 30px 0 30px; }

#Calendario {
	background: transparent url("../imagens/bgCalendario.jpg") no-repeat center top;
	font-weight: bold;
	width: 300px;
	height: 300px;
	float: right;
	margin: 20px 0 0 0;
}
#Calendario #Interno { margin: 30px 30px 0 30px; }



-------------------- */